Sister Cities

La Plata has signed long-lasting cooperative ties in the nature of twinning, with the following cities on the dates specified:

  • Porto Alegre (Brazil) 1982
  • Bologna (Italy) 1988-11-23
  • Beersheva (Israel) 1989-04-18
  • Zaragoza (Spain) 1990-10-12
  • Asunción (Paraguay) 1993-02-20
  • Concepción (Chile) 1993
  • Louisville, (U.S.) 1994
  • Maldonado (Uruguay) 1994
  • Santa Cruz de la Sierra (Bolivia) 1994
  • Sucre (Bolivia) 1994
  • Anghiari (Italy) 1998-11-18
  • Bivongi (Italy) 2012
  • Boulogne-sur-Mer (France) 2000-06-07
  • Liverpool (England) 2005
  • Santa Ana de Coro (Venezuela) 2007
  • Jiujiang (China) 2008
  • Toluca (México) 2010
